Advantages of Running Machines
Running machines use myriad advantages for people of all physical fitness levels. Whether one is a seasoned runner or a novice, treadmills supply different advantages, which consist of:
Convenience:
Treadmills permit for indoor running, untouched by weather conditions or time of day. This convenience indicates that users can stick to their fitness routines year-round.
Customizable Workouts:
Most modern-day running machines come equipped with functions that permit users to adjust speed, slope, and programmed exercises, making it possible for customized fitness experiences.
Injury Prevention:
Compared to outdoor running, treadmills often include cushioned surfaces, which can minimize the effect on joints and lower the danger of injuries.
Tracking Progress:
Many running machines have built-in screens that track range, speed, calories burned, and heart rate, providing users with important feedback on their development.
Multi-Functional Use:
Many treadmills have the ability for walking, running, and running, making them flexible machines suitable for all fitness levels.
Types of Running Machines
When considering a running machine, it's important to understand the various types available on the market. Below is a list of the most common types:
Manual Treadmills:
These treadmills don't have a motor and depend on the user's effort to develop the motion. They are frequently more cost effective but require more effort to utilize.
Motorized Treadmills:
Motorized treadmills are the most popular option and come with various functions, consisting of multiple speed settings and programmable workouts.
Foldable Treadmills:
Ideal for little living areas, these machines can be folded up for storage when not in usage. They normally feature less bells and whistles due to their compact nature.
Commercial Treadmills:
Commonly utilized in gyms and gym, these treadmills are developed for heavy use and typically included sophisticated features and higher weight limits.
Smart Treadmills:
Equipped with connectivity functions, clever treadmills can sync with physical fitness apps and websites, offering users real-time data and customized workout strategies.
Purchasing a Running Machine in the UK
When picking a running machine, it's essential to keep numerous elements in mind to ensure that the right option is made. Below is a checklist of factors to consider:
Budget:
Determine how much you want to spend. Treadmills can differ substantially in rate, from budget models to high-end business machines.
Space Availability:
Measure the area where you plan to position the treadmill to ensure it fits easily, and think about collapsible designs if space is restricted.
Features:
Look for functions that fit your workout design, such as adjustable slopes, integrated workout programs, heart rate screens, and Bluetooth connectivity.
Warranty and Support:
Opt for makers that offer guarantees and dependable client assistance. A great warranty can protect your investment.
User Reviews:
Reading consumer reviews can offer insights into the efficiency and dependability of different models.

Using a running machine is just one part of the equation; maintaining it is equally crucial for durability and efficiency. Below are vital upkeep pointers:
Regular Cleaning:
Dust and sweat can build up on the machine. Routinely wipe down surface areas to prevent accumulation.
Lubrication:
Ensure that the treadmill belt is appropriately lubricated to minimize friction and wear. Seek advice from the manufacturer's recommendations for maintenance schedules.
Inspect the Belt Alignment:
Occasionally, the running belt may need alignment. This can normally be adjusted with the supplied tools and directions.
Check Wiring and Components:
Periodically examine for any signs of wear in electrical elements. If something appears awry, seek advice from a professional service technician.
Follow the User Manual:
Keep the user handbook useful and follow any particular recommendations for maintenance and care.
